Say hello to Liz everyone!!
Liz graduated from the University of Iowa with a BA in Communication Studies. Since then, she has worked several different roles within UI Health Care, currently as an administrative coordinator in the Patient Access Center. Her favorite part of all the jobs she has held has been getting to know patients and staff and helping them in small ways that make their day better. Liz became interested in marriage and family therapy while learning to view her own patterns and struggles through a systemic lens and developed a passion for helping others to seek clarity and healing in the same way.
Liz believes that relational health precipitates overall mental health and takes a systemic approach to addressing presenting concerns. You are the expert in your own life, and she looks forward to supporting you on your journey to well-being, whatever that looks like for you. She recognizes that life experiences can vary vastly and wants to meet you exactly where you are and work with you to elicit growth and change in a way that is meaningful to you. Guided by values of authenticity and humor, Liz strives to create a safe and healing environment for everyone while simultaneously offering challenges for clients that prompt deep self-reflection and open-mindedness.
When she is not working or at the Olson Clinic, Liz enjoys listening to true crime podcasts, cooking, traveling, and getting outside as much as possible, especially when it involves a cold, clear body of water.
